An important mystery in our family focuses on the town of Janów, in the year 1863: A birth certificate for a member of our family mentions that all of the records for 1863 and earlier were destroyed in a fire. 1863 is also about the year when part of our Englander family left Janów and moved to the nearby towns of Przyrow and Mstów (and, later, Zarki and Czestochowa). So, what happened in 1863 to cause these events?? This small chapter of history from the town of Janów explains what happened in that year:

On 6 July 1863, during an insurrection against Russia, a squad (about 200 people) of Colonel Zygmunt Chmielinski attacked and destroyed the Russian forces which were stationed in Janów, and they intercepted a transport of the tsar's gold. Three days later, Colonel Ernroth (commandant of Czestochowa) came to Janów with his squad, and burned down the entire village! Some of citizens of Janów were killed and their bodies were thrown into a well located in the center of the city. Ernroth then attacked Chmielinski's forces (near the village of Smiertny Dab), but Chmielisnki was able to withdraw without losses.

What does our name "Englander" mean? Nothing, as far as I can tell. Jews first began having surnames around 1825 or earlier. In many cases, they were simply assigned surnames.

If you find a random person named Englander or Englender, is the person likely to be a cousin of ours? Probaby no, because Englander was a very common name among Jews and non-Jews in Poland, Hungary, Austria, Czechoslovakia, and Germany. If, on the other hand, you find someone named Englander or Englender who is Jewish and from the area near Czestochowa, Poland, then there is a very good chance they are related to us!

Below, you will find an overview of our family tree. Note that the spelling "Englender" vs. "Englander" is of no significance. In Poland, our family spoke Yiddish and Hebrew, but most did not read or write. The registration office recorded the documents in Polish. But in the late 1800s, when Poland was governed by Russia, the documents were recorded in Russian (by Poles who spoke almost no Russian!). Therefore, there was a huge amount of room for misspellings and mistakes!

I have collected all of this information from a variety of sources, including birth, marriage, and death records (from Poland, the USA, and France); passenger manifests (for the trip from Poland); naturalization records (USA and France); census records (USA: 1900, 1910, and 1920); city directory records (1890-1935); and other documents. I have been pleased and surprised to discover that the vital registration offices of Poland have the birth, marriage, and death records for nearly every city in Poland, going back to about 1808.
